Bhutan was established by Zhabdrung Ngawang Namgyel, who also ruled it for more than 35 years. He died in 1651, but his passing was kept a secret for more than 54 years on the grounds that he had gone into a strict retreat.

Explain about greatest contribution of zhabdrung ngawang  Namgyal?

Zhabdrung means "at whose feet one submits," which is what happened when the populace swore to submit completely by prostrating themselves at his feet. Additionally, Zhabdrung instituted a dual form of government. Zhabdrung presided over the state as its leader, and he was succeeded by his reincarnation.

A famous Buddhist monk and statesman named zhabdrung Ngawang Namgyal developed a dual system of government in the 17th century, with the Je Khenpo (Chief Abbot) serving as the head of the religious order and the Deb Raja serving as the administrative head.

The Zhabdrung was responsible for transforming the Kagyu religious teachings into a system that was uniquely Bhutanese. He also established the tsechu festival and specified the national clothing.

Factory laws weren't followed because they weren't necessary. As a result, dangerous machinery was used, which frequently and seriously injured workers. Risks were increased by working extremely long hours, frequently late at night.

What issues did workers in industries face?

People became aware of the poor working conditions in many factories and began to campaign for improvements. Factory owners were vehemently opposed, believing it would slow down production and raise the cost of their products. Many people also objected to the government meddling in their affairs.

Some parents, for example, required their children to work from a young age in order to help feed the family. By 1833, the government had passed the first of many acts governing working conditions and hours.

Initially, there was little power to enforce these acts, but as the century progressed, the rules became more stringent. Nonetheless, by today's standards, the hours and working conditions were still very harsh, and no rules were in place to protect adult male workers.

The American Disabilities Act (ADA) of 1990 is a civil rights statute that forbids discrimination against people with disabilities in all spheres of public life.

Effects of American Disabilities Act (ADA) of 1990:

It made it illegal to discriminate against people based on their infirmities.It demanded that all public institutions provide accessibility to individuals who have impairments.Employers are required to provide reasonable adjustments for employees with impairment.

Ensuring that individuals with impairments have the same rights and privileges as everyone else is the objective of the law. In accordance with the ADA, disabled individuals receive the same protections for civil rights as people who are discriminated against because of their ethnicity, color, sex, nationality, age, or creed. It guarantees that disabled individuals have access to amenities, job opportunities, transportation, state and municipal government services, and communications.

Cottage enterprises that had started to emerge along Broad Street in the late 1600s were encouraged by Newark's first significant industry, leather tanning, after the Revolutionary War.

How did Newark fare under industrialization?Newark, which received city status in 1836, soon became the heart of one of the country's major industrial hubs. The initial wave of immigrants that came to Newark in the 1800s enabled the city's industrial expansion.In the late 1800s, African Americans started relocating to Newark, particularly during the industrial boom of World War I. Between 1920 and 1930, over 22,000 black people immigrated. The African American community, which tripled in size between 1940 and 1960 and made up 34% of Newark's population at that time, experienced an additional surge due to the war-related industry.Innovative inventors like Thomas Edison, who invented the ticker tape machine while living in Newark, were drawn to the city by its industrial growth.However, manufacturing wasn't the only significant industry in the area. The Newark Banking and Insurance Company was founded in 1804 and was soon followed by the Mutual Benefit Life Insurance Company in 1845 and the Newark Mutual Assurance Company (also known as the Newark Fire Insurance Company) in 1810. The Prudential Insurance Company was established in Newark in 1875 by John F. Dryden.Newark suffered greatly during the Civil War. When the war broke out, Newark was compelled to switch its emphasis from commercial trade to government contracts. The city had been exporting a substantial amount of its goods to the South. Another blow from the Great Depression struck Newark's manufacturing sector, putting many people out of work and starting a trend of emigration to the suburbs.

The first women's rights convention in the United States was held on July 19 and 20, 1848, at the Wesleyan Chapel in Seneca Falls, New York. Activist and leader Elizabeth Cady Stanton drafted The Declaration of Sentiments at that conference, which advocated for women's equality and suffrage.

The Declaration of Sentiments begins by stating that all men and women are equal and that both genders have unalienable rights to life, liberty, and the pursuit of happiness.
